On Jan. 31,1940, they were united in marriage at St. Luke’s Catholic hurch in Plain. They celebrated 63 years of marriage before Florence lied on May 4, 2003. He was a devoted, lifelong member of St, Luke'slatholic Church.Allie and Florence worked together as farming partners until 1967, riving up farming after Allie was struck by lightning. Allie also worked it Badger Army Ammunition Plant and retired from the village of Plain is a maintenance worker in the days of twice-a-week garbage collection jsing a raised flatbed truck and sweeping the streets by hand.Allie and Florence spent countless days together fishing the trout itreams in Bear valley and gardening. They worked together on wood-working projects with Allie doing the cutting and sanding and Flo doing:he finishing and decorating. Flo was a great quiiter but working quietly oehind the scenes Allie was the precision cutter of the fabric squares He was known for his tree and shrub trimming expertise. Allie lived the high life by following doctor’s orders to have one beer a day, even though his first bottle always seemed to have a hole in it,Allie is survived by six children and their spouses, Edith (Richard) Hochstetter of Albany.
